Important Safety Information
This section presents important information intended to ensure
safe and effective use of this product. Read this section carefully,
and store it in an accessible location.
Key to Symbols
The symbols in this manual are identified by their level of
importance, as defined below. Read the following carefully before
handling the product.
WARNING:
Warnings must be followed carefully to avoid serious bodily injury.
CAUTION:
Cautions must be observed to avoid minor injury to yourself or damage
to your equipment.
Safety Precautions
WARNING:
Turn off the power switch immediately and unplug the DC plug from the
IM-800 or AC adapter OI-MR01 if the DM-M820 produces smoke, a
strange odor, or unusual noise. Continued use may lead to fire or
electric shock. Contact your dealer or an EPSON service center for
advice.
The DM-M820 contains a glass panel. If the DM-M820 is dropped or
treated roughly, the glass may break.
Never disassemble or modify this product. Tampering with this product
may result in injury, fire, or electric shock.
Do not place your LCD Monitor in direct sunlight or near a heat source.
Do not allow foreign objects to fall into this product. Penetration by
foreign objects may lead to fire or shock.
If water or other liquid spills into this product, turn off the power switch,
unplug the DC plug immediately, and then contact your dealer or an
EPSON service center for advice. Continued usage may lead to fire or
shock.

Handling Guidelines
Features
The DM-M820 is an LCD unit designed to be connected to an
EPSON PC-POS system.
The DM-M820 has the following features:
❏A 12.1 inch color TFT LCD of 800 × 600 dots is used.
❏Model selections include with or without touch panel, and with
or without MSR.
❏A tilt mechanism for easy positioning of the screen viewing
angle
❏A cable cover or a unified cable performs cable management
effectively
❏Display settings of the LCD and the brightness of the backlight
can be adjusted
❏A stain-resistant touch panel is used.
❏Input by finger touch using the resistive film type of touch
panel (only for models with a touch panel)
❏An MSR unit can read ISO/JIS Track 1, 2, or 3 (only for models
with an MSR unit). This MSR can be used only with the IM-800.

DM-M820 User’s Manual 5
English
❏Power is supplied from the DC 12V output of the IM-800 or the
AC Adapter OI-MR01.
Related Software
The software utilities listed below are available. If you use a touch
panel, install the touch panel driver from the Touch Panel Driver
CD-ROM for the DM-M820 included in the box. If you use the MSR
for the IM-800, install the MSR utility from the Driver CD-ROM for
the IM-800 included in the box of the IM-800.
❏Touch panel driver: For each operating system (for Windows
98/NT/2000/XP, and MS-DOS)
❏MSR utility: For each operating system (for Windows 98/NT/
2000/XP, and MS-DOS)
Precautions During Use
❏One of the characteristics of the LCD display generally is that
some pixels may not always turn on or off, or there may be an
unevenness of brightness or color. Note that this may not be a
malfunction.
❏Use the DM-M820 only under the specified conditions.
Otherwise, problems could occur, such as shortened life, poor
display quality, or damage. Particularly, avoid using in high
temperatures or high humidity, and never allow condensation
to form on the DM-M820.
❏Since the DM-M820 is not waterproof, do not use the DM-M820
in an environment where water may be splashed or spilled on
the unit.
❏Wipe the touch panel surface lightly with a soft cloth or a cloth
moistened with ethanol or isopropyl alcohol.
❏Do not use solid or sharp materials, such as a ball-point pen, to
input data to the touch panel.
❏The DC plug on the exclusive cable is designed only for the
IM-800 and AC Adapter OI-MR01. Do not use the DC plug on a
system other than the IM-800 or AC Adapter OI-MR01.
❏Do not stop sliding the card during the reading of the data. This
may cause a read error.
❏The DM-M820 converts the read data to keyboard scan codes
and transmits them to the IM-800. Therefore, do not use the
keyboard while the MSR is reading a card.
❏Use specified magnetic cards with JIS or ISO format.

Setup
Placing the DM-M820
Do not place the DM-M820 near the CRT, switching power supply,
compressor, or any other device that emits magnetic or inductive
noise.
Cables of the DM-M820 come out under the base unit as shown in
illustration G. You can either make a hole in the surface on which
the DM-M820 will be used or you can break out the base tab
(number 10 in illustration F) with pliers and run the cables through
the hole made by removing the tab, as shown in illustration G.
CAUTION:
If burrs are left after the tab is removed, they may cause cuts or
scratches. Remove the burrs with a nipper or file.
Connecting to the IM-800 or PC
Follow the steps below:
1. Turn off the power of the IM-800 (or PC); then remove the rear
cover and unplug the AC cable.

DM-M820 User’s Manual 7
English
2. Connect the connector of the DM-M820 to the IM-800. See
illustrations A, Band C. If you connect the DM-M820 to a PC,
connect it properly, referring to the PC manuals.
Note:
Cable A is for models with an MSR and a touch panel.
Cable B is for models without an MSR and without a touch panel.
Cable C is for models with a touch panel and without an MSR.
*Applies only to models with a touch panel **Applies only to models with an MSR
3. Attach the AC cable of the IM-800 (or PC); then attach the rear
cover.
Installing the Touch Panel Driver for the IM-800 or PC
For models with a touch panel
If you use a touch panel, install the touch panel driver from the
Touch Panel driver CD-ROM for the DM-M820.
Install the touch panel driver after installing the operating system
on the IM-800 (or PC).
The touch panel driver may differ depending on the operating
system installed. Use the suitable driver for the operating system.
Install File Windows setup.exe
MS-DOS install.exe
Be sure to calibrate the touch panel when the DM-M820 is first used
and if misalignment occurs between the touch point and the mouse
cursor.

Using an MSR Utility for the IM-800
For models with an MSR
The MSR utility can change the settings of the MSR in the
DM-M820. The MSR utility has the following features:
❏PKMODE32 (MSR/keyboard setting utility for Windows 98/
NT/2000/XP) and PKMODE2 (MSR/keyboard setting utility
for MS-DOS):
It is possible to specify the track to be read, the data to add in
reading, or the beeper sound.
❏PKLOAD32 (MSR/keyboard auto setting utility for Windows
98/NT/2000/XP) and PKLOAD (MSR/keyboard auto setting
utility for MS-DOS):
It is possible to set the MSR automatically, using a file
containing the MSR setting data.
Power
The power of the DM-M820 is supplied from the DC12V of the
IM-800 or AC Adapter OI-MR01.
Press the power switch to turn the power on or off.
Indicators
LEDs
There are two LEDs: the power LED for the LCD unit and the LED
for the MSR. These LEDs have the following meaning:
* Applies only to models with an MSR unit.
The AC Adapter OI-MR01 has a Power LED. When power is
supplied, the Power LED lights green.
LED Color Meaning
Power LED Green Power is on (during normal operation).
Flashing green No video input signal detected.
Off Power is off.
MSR* Green Card reading is successful.
Orange Card reading has failed.
Off Waiting for card reading or power is off.

DM-M820 User’s Manual 9
English
Beep (only for models with an MSR)
The beeper can be enabled or disabled with the MSR utility. If
enabled, the beeper sounds once for a successful card reading and
three times for an unsuccessful card reading.
Operation
Adjusting the View Angle
The tilt mechanism of the LCD monitor allows you to adjust it to a
comfortable viewing angle.
Hold both sides of the display and adjust the angle as shown in
illustration J.
How to Read a Magnetic Stripe Card
Slide the card through the slot with the magnetic stripe facing
down.
The MSR can read the data whether the user slides the card from
left to right or right to left, as shown in illustration K.
Do not stop sliding the card during the reading of data. This may
cause a read error.
Do not use the keyboard while the MSR is reading a card.
When magnetic card data has a header or footer, make the proper
settings with the MSR utility.
Display Adjustment
To adjust the LCD display, use the On-Screen Display (OSD) menu.
To adjust the OSD menu with the Function buttons, use the
Adjustment buttons and Power button.
Function buttons
Adjustmentbuttons
Power button

10 DM-M820 User’s Manual
English
If you press the ↓Function
button once when the OSD
menu is not displayed, the
message shown on the right
appears and the LCD is
adjusted automatically.
❏Displaying and closing the OSD menu
To display the On-Screen
Display menu, press the ↑
Function button once.
ToclosetheOSDmenu,
pressthePowerbutton
once.
❏Changing the language
To select “Misc-Control” in the Main menu, press the ↑or ↓
Function button. To select the Sub menu, press the + Adjustment
button once. To select Language, press the ↑or ↓Function button in
the Sub menu. To select the language you want, press the + or -
Adjustment button. The available languages are English, German,
French, Spanish, Italian, and Japanese. To close the OSD menu,
press the Power button twice.
❏Selecting a function in the Main menu
To select a function in the Main menu, press the ↑or ↓Function
button.
❏Selecting a function in the Sub menu
To select a function in the Sub menu, press the + Adjustment
button once. To adjust the selected function in the Sub menu, press
the ↑or ↓Function button.
To return from the Sub menu to the Main menu, press the Power
button once.

Troubleshooting
The power is not on
❏Is the power switch pressed?
❏Is the power of the IM-800 (or PC) on?
❏Is the DC plug connected to the IM-800 or AC Adapter
OI-MR01?
❏If an AC Adapter is used, is the Power LED of the AC Adapter
on? If the LED is not on, is the AC cable plugged in and is the
AC power on?
The screen is blank
❏Is the Power LED flashing? (When it is flashing, no video
signals have been received.)
❏Is the power of the IM-800 (or PC) on?
❏Is the IM-800 (or PC) in the suspend mode? Or is the screen in an
economy electric power mode? Enter a character with the
keyboard of the IM-800 (or PC) to see if the screen will wake up.
❏Is the Display connector connected?
The touch panel is not recognized (With a Touch Panel model)
❏Is the touch panel driver installed in the IM-800 (or PC) ?
❏Are the touch panel settings of the IM-800 (or PC) correct?
(Touch Panel Drivers or Serial Ports)
❏Is the serial port connector connected?

14 DM-M820 User’s Manual
English
An MSR card cannot be read (With an MSR model)
❏Is the card specification correct?
❏Is the card sliding through the slot with the magnetic stripe
facing down?
❏Is data being entered from a keyboard while the card is sliding
through the slot? You may have to disconnect the keyboard.
❏Is the PS/2 keyboard connector connected?
MSR data is incorrect (With an MSR model)
❏Is the setting of the MSR utility correct?
